Organisational “Culture”: Some Implications for Managers and Trainers
Abstract
What is Culture? For any given group or organisation that has had a substantial history, culture is the pattern of basic assumptions that the group has invented, discovered or developed in learning to cope with its problems of external adaptation and internal integration.
